Children’s Creative Workshops
Every week is a new adventure! These stand-alone workshops are built around a different theme each session, weaving together elements of drama, dance, music, art, and a magical visit from our Storyteller.
Led by Chickenshed’s brilliant team, each workshop is designed to spark imagination, build confidence, and explore creativity through play and performance.
No experience needed - just come along and join in the fun!
Who's it for?
These workshops are perfect for children aged 5–7 who love stories, movement, and making things up! Whether you’ve been to Chickenshed before or it’s your first time, everyone is welcome.
You can book individual sessions or join us every week - booking is highly recommended as places fill up quickly.

What is Sunday Shed?
Sunday Shed is the perfect way to get involved with Chickenshed for the first time. There are drop-in workshops and performance projects held every Sunday!
Sunday Shed for Children and Young People
Sunday Shed are weekly drop in workshops for children and young people.
